Context

This verse from 1 Samuel Chapter 11 connects to 10 cross-references. Nahash the Ammonite threatens to gouge out the right eye of every man in Jabesh-gilead; the Spirit of God comes upon Saul, who rallies 330,000 men and rescues the city.
